Roadway Engineer, Civil
AECOM
Job Description We are seeking a senior Roadway Engineer to support and oversee transportation and infrastructure projects within the Orlando, Florida region. The Engineer will provide technical expertise, leadership, and construction engineering inspection support to ensure projects meet contract requirements, quality standards, and schedules. Responsibilities Serve as senior technical resource and advisor for assigned projects and team members. Provide specialized technical input to studies and design work within the area of expertise. Develop study and design procedures to facilitate high‑quality, cost‑effective work by others. Participate in interdisciplinary review of project deliverables and provide constructive feedback. Act as Engineer of Record for small to medium‑size transportation improvement projects. Develop construction cost estimates and estimates of technical effort with accuracy and detail. Apply expertise throughout all steps of completing the discipline component of PS&E packages. Perform quality control review of design calculations, drawings, and technical documentation. Prepare and review technical specification sections for completeness and compliance. Provide input to the development of engineering budgets and schedules to meet project requirements. Mentor junior engineers and technical staff for professional development. Manage client and stakeholder communications regarding technical matters and project status. Ensure compliance with FDOT design criteria, standards, and regulatory requirements throughout project delivery. Lead small to mid‑sized project teams and coordinate efforts across multiple disciplines. Perform independent technical reviews demonstrating knowledge of multiple engineering disciplines. Identify opportunities for process improvement and innovation in design methodologies and project delivery. Qualifications Minimum Requirements Bachelor's degree in civil engineering plus 6 years of related experience or equivalent. Valid U.S. driver's license; must pass Motor Vehicle Records review. Professional Engineer (PE) license in Florida or ability to obtain reciprocity within 6 months. U.S. citizenship required. Familiarity with FDOT plan production and design criteria. Preferred Qualifications Strong judgment in proactively identifying and solving operational challenges, establishing objectives, and developing standards. Experience with Bentley Open Roads and 3D modeling. Ability to design typical sections, alignments, plan and section drawings. Ability to lead small teams to complete projects. Perform independent technical reviews with knowledge of multiple disciplines. Additional Information Relocation assistance is not available for this position. Sponsorship for U.S. employment authorization is not available now or in the future. Compensation range: $100,000 to $150,000 per year.
